A7 — Design memo (due at the start of demo day)
In one sentence. Tell a Head of Product what you built, what the market showed, which pieces you actually needed, and whether a licensed firm should go / partner / pass.
Stuck? Handbook → Session 13 unbundle table + Sources at the end of the handbook. Reuse A1–A6 facts; write the unbundle and the recommendation new. For the shape of heading 5 only, see the SAMPLE unbundle paragraph (laundry, not EAGE).
Use these eight headings
- The problem and the community
- The mechanism — who mints, the cap, what the claim/redemption is
- Circulation evidence — tx hashes and the pool
- What the market revealed — price, depth, who traded, thin book or IL
- Unbundle the stack — Did you need a chain, or a shared list? Consensus, or a registrar? A token, or an escrow tab? Which pieces did the financial work?
- What broke — one true operations story
- Go / partner / pass — one verb, then why a licensed fintech should copy, rent, or ignore this rail
- Sources — at least three: (i) babysitting co-op or Sarafu, (ii) one Naranjo result (PoW / AMM / peg), (iii) one MIT or BIS idea. Use the handbook Sources list. A blog recap is not enough.
Rules
- No hype paragraph. No price prediction.
- Numbers beat adjectives.
- If the memo is individual: teammates may share logs; the unbundle and recommendation must be your own words.
This is not a whitepaper and not a pitch deck.
